5 Reasons Why You Need an Education Law Attorney

If you’re running a school district, managing a college or university, or simply involved in any aspect of education, you will undoubtedly encounter legal issues that need an expert’s perspective. In such situations, it is essential to have a skilled education law attorney by your side. Education law attorneys are experienced in areas of law that pertain to education, and their expertise can help you navigate legal issues related to education effectively. Here are five reasons why you need an education law attorney.

1. Ensuring Compliance with State and Federal Laws

Laws and regulations governing education are extensive and constantly evolving. An education law attorney can help schools, colleges, and universities ensure their compliance with state and federal laws. Education law attorneys are well-versed in regulations such as the Family Educational Rights and Privacy Act (FERPA), Title IX, and the Individuals with Disabilities Education Act (IDEA), to name a few. They help prevent misunderstandings or legal violations and help institutions understand their obligations and liabilities. By doing so, they promote a safe and inclusive learning environment.

2. Protecting Institutions from Lawsuits

Legal proceedings can be costly and time-consuming. In addition to required expenses, lawsuits can also tarnish the reputation of institutions and negatively impact their finances. Education law attorneys can provide risk management guidance to protect against potential legal issues and prevent litigation. By educating their clients about potential risks, advising on compliance and promoting good risk management, education law attorneys can help institutions avoid lawsuits, and, if lawsuits arise, develop and implement strategies to help minimize damages.

3. Defending Institutions in Court

Institutions accused of legal violations require representation in court. Education law attorneys offer excellent representation in legal proceedings. These experts are experienced in a range of legal issues and understand the unique culture and needs of educational institutions. Education law attorneys help to fight legal charges by presenting a solid defense on behalf of their clients. With their legal expertise, they can challenge accusations and protect the institution’s rights.

4. Providing Expert Insights and Guidance

Education law attorneys are the go-to experts for legal issues related to education. Schools, colleges, and universities can consult them when developing institutional policies and implementing new programs. They can also advise on various other issues such as hiring/firing staff, arranging compensation packages, reviewing contracts/agreements, student discipline, academic freedom, governance, and accreditation issues. Education law attorneys can provide expert insights on such issues that are tailored to the needs of educational institutions.

5. Mediating Conflict Resolution

Education law attorneys are proficient in conflict resolution, which is often essential to resolve disputes effectively and efficiently. Conflicts in educational institutions can involve multiple stakeholders, including teachers, students, administrators, and other employees. Education law attorneys can act as mediators in such conflicts and help parties negotiate a mutually acceptable agreement. They can also provide legal representation and legal opinion during the negotiation process.
